Mont Belvieu City Park
Within the baseball / softball complex "Pocket Parks", the terraced seating concept was integral to the City's commmitment to achieving a high quality and timeless project. These concrete bleachers are "sculpted" from gently sloped berms nestled around each field. The seating is covered by vibrant shade sails, and is intentionally broad, allowing for lawn chairs and typical bleacher cushions to be chosen. The berms will provide seating and shade for visitors, and important screening of the activities between fields, enhancing the playing and viewing experience. In keeping with the spirit of diverse use intended by the "Pocket Park" design, the durability and broadness of the seating creates places for people to relax while their children explore the "hill" from shady steps and broad terraces.
